#B75832 Hex Color Code

#B75832

The Hexadecimal Color #B75832 is a contrast shade of Sienna. #B75832 RGB value is rgb(183, 88, 50). RGB Color Model of #B75832 consists of 71% red, 34% green and 19% blue. HSL color Mode of #B75832 has 17°(degrees) Hue, 57% Saturation and 46% Lightness. #B75832 color has an wavelength of 609.2963n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#B75832 is #CC6633.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#B75832 is #B53. The Closest Color to #B75832 is #A0522D. Official Name of #B75832 Hex Code is Tuscany.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#B75832

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
